Offline games via Wi-Fi and Bluetooth

You donโ€™t always have access to a stable Internet, but this is not a reason to give up co-gaming. Local multiplayer is experiencing a renaissance thanks to Wi-Fi Direct and Bluetooth technologies. Soul Knight is a bright representative of this genre, offering dynamic roguelike action with pixel graphics. You can create a local room and go through dungeons side by side without using traffic.

Another great option is BombSquad, a fun arcade game with ragdoll physics where the main goal is to blow up your friends in various ways. The controls may not be the most comfortable on a touchscreen, but the chaos on the battlefield more than makes up for it. For racing fans, Asphalt 8 or 9 is suitable, where the "Local multiplayer" mode allows you to organize a tournament right in a cafe or park.

  • ๐Ÿ“ถ Soul Knight - an ideal cooperative shooter for playing without the Internet.
  • ๐Ÿ’ฃ BombSquad - the best arcade game for a fun company and throwing phones to each other.
  • ๐ŸŽ๏ธ Asphalt 9 - beautiful races with the ability to create a local lobby.

To organize such a session, one of the players needs to create a host server in the game menu, and the rest need to find it in the list of available networks. Make sure that all devices are connected to the same Wi-Fi network, even if this network does not have Internet access. In some cases, you may need to enable Mobile hotspot on one of the smartphones.

Technical requirements and optimization

In order for the cooperative game to be enjoyable and not frustrating due to lags, it is necessary to take into account the technical capabilities of the devices. Heavy projects like Genshin Impact or Call of Duty require at least 4 GB of RAM and a Snapdragon 700 series processor or equivalent from MediaTek. On older devices, such games may be unstable or heat up the case.

Before starting a gaming session, it is recommended to close all background applications to free up RAM. Go to Settings โ†’ Applications and force stop unnecessary services. It is also worth disabling automatic updates in Google Play so that they do not start downloading data at the most crucial moment of the match.

If you play on the mobile data, monitor your traffic consumption. Online shooters can use up 50 to 100 MB per hour, which can be an unpleasant surprise if you don't have an unlimited plan. In the game settings there is often an item Saving trafficthat limits the loading of additional textures and resources.

It is also important to take into account the temperature regime. Long sessions of graphically intensive games lead to throttling - reducing the processor frequency for cooling. This causes sudden drops in FPS. Use external coolers for smartphones or remove the case for better heat dissipation during long tournaments.

Why does the phone get hot during the game?

The processor and graphics accelerator work at their limit, generating heat. In the closed case of the smartphone, this heat does not have time to dissipate, which leads to heating of the battery and case.

Frequently asked questions (FAQ)

Is it possible to play with friends if we have different operating systems (Android and iOS)?

In most modern cross-platform games, such as PUBG Mobile, Call of Duty, Minecraft and Roblox, it's possible. However, in some projects, especially exclusive or older ones, cross-play may be limited. Always check for the cross-platform icon in the game description.

How to reduce ping in online games on Android?

Try switching from mobile data to 5 GHz Wi-Fi. If this is not possible, close all applications that use the network (YouTube, browser). Selecting a server in the game settings that is geographically closer to your location will also help.

Do all players need to buy the game for local multiplayer?

Depends on the specific game. In free projects (Free-to-play) no purchase is required. In paid games, such as Terraria or Minecraft, a license is usually required for each participant in the session, although there are exceptions for some guest access modes.

Why does the game crash when connecting to a friend?

This may be due to incompatible versions of the game client. Make sure all participants have the latest version of the application. The problem may also lie in a lack of RAM or overheating of the device.

How to record a joint game on video?

Use the built-in screen recording feature in Android (notification shade โ†’ Screen Recording) or third-party applications like AZ Screen Recorder. Please note that recording may place additional load on the processor and reduce FPS.
